🔧 Как поставить апостроф в питоне: простое руководство для начинающих
apostrophe = 'апостроф'
print(apostrophe)
quotation_marks = "кавычки"
print(quotation_marks)
Оба этих примера выведут на экран строку, содержащую соответствующий символ. Вы можете выбрать любой из вариантов в зависимости от своих предпочтений или требований вашего кода.
Детальный ответ
Как поставить апостроф в питоне
При программировании на Python апострофы (') или кавычки (") используются для обозначения строковых данных. Иногда возникает задача поставить символ апострофа внутри строки. Давайте рассмотрим несколько способов, как сделать это.
Способ 1: Использование обратной косой черты
В Python обратная косая черта (\) является символом экранирования. Когда вы ставите этот символ перед апострофом, он говорит интерпретатору, что следующий символ в строке не должен быть интерпретирован как специальный символ, а должен быть воспринят буквально. Пример:
string_with_apostrophe = 'It\'s a sunny day'
print(string_with_apostrophe) # Выводит: It's a sunny day
Способ 2: Использование разных типов кавычек
В Python вы также можете использовать разные типы кавычек для обозначения строковых данных. Если ваша строка содержит апостроф, вы можете заключить ее в двойные кавычки (") или наоборот, если строка содержит двойные кавычки, вы можете использовать одиночные кавычки ('). Пример:
string_with_apostrophe = "It's a sunny day"
print(string_with_apostrophe) # Выводит: It's a sunny day
Способ 3: Использование метода replace()
Python также предоставляет метод replace()
, который можно использовать для замены символов в строке. Вы можете использовать этот метод для замены апострофа на другой символ, а затем заменить его обратно на апостроф. Пример:
string_with_apostrophe = "Its a sunny day"
string_with_apostrophe = string_with_apostrophe.replace("s", "'")
print(string_with_apostrophe) # Выводит: It's a sunny day
Способ 4: Использование форматирования строк
Python предоставляет мощный способ форматирования строк с использованием метода format()
или f-строк (начиная с Python 3.6). С помощью этих методов вы можете вставить значение апострофа в строку, указав его как переменную или с помощью двойного апострофа. Пример:
apostrophe = "'"
string_with_apostrophe = "It{}s a sunny day".format(apostrophe)
print(string_with_apostrophe) # Выводит: It's a sunny day
string_with_apostrophe = f"It{'s'} a sunny day"
print(string_with_apostrophe) # Выводит: It's a sunny day
Это некоторые из способов, как вы можете поставить апостроф в Python. Их выбор зависит от вашего личного предпочтения и конкретной ситуации. Используйте тот, который наиболее удобен для вас.